.NET Developer in Greensboro, NC

ADT Security   •  

Greensboro, NC 27401

Industry: Consumer Technology

  •  

Less than 5 years

Posted 56 days ago

The ADT Corporation (NYSE: ADT) is a leading provider of security and automation solutions in the United States and Canada, protecting homes and businesses, people on-the-go and digital networks. Making security more accessible than ever before, and backed by 24/7 customer support, ADT is committed to providing superior customer service with a focus on speed and quality of responsiveness, helping customers feel safer and empowered. ADT is headquartered in Boca Raton, Florida and employs approximately 19,000 people throughout North America.

Ke

Key Responsibilities:

The Development Engineer works, individually or as part of a team, on thedevelopment, deployment, management and support of strategic softwaredevelopment and associated QA resources. Developers must establish, maintain, and improve on specific softwarecoding skills, including but not limited to C#, HTML, CSS, and JS to deploysoftware on Microsoft Windows operating systems. Actively participates in Agile/Scrum projectmanagement to reach and document milestones at each stage of the SoftwareDevelopment Life Cycle.


JoRequirements:

· Strong understanding of .NET, C#, and SQL isrequired. Requires 2+ years as a developer. Requires experience developing, deploying, and troubleshooting desktop orweb-server-based applications.

· Experience developing plugins, workflows and dialogsfor Microsoft CRM is a plus.

· ASP.NET MVC, or Web Forms experience is required. You must know one of these well enough to begiven application requirements and build a web interface. Suggested hands on experience should be 2years.

· Participates in Agile project management andaccepts ownership of specific projects as directed. Communicates application requirements,timetables, contingencies, and deployment schedules with Development team andDirector. Conduct end-user interviews todetermine application requirements and related feature feasibilitystudies. Applies time management andresource allocation with a high degree of autonomy.

· Communication is vital to avoid duplication ofefforts, reuse of existing custom code, alignment of efforts, and successfultime management. Works on specific goalsand milestones independently and in small teams. Meets and communicates regularly withDirector and team to assess progress and realign efforts towards the success ofdepartmental and organizational goals.

· Participates in the direct and indirect support ofapplications based on user feedback and suggestions. Performs continuous QA based on userfeedback, application and service logs, and reported errors.

Valid Through: 2019-11-11